Kazakhstan Launches 14 Investigations into OSMS Fund Embezzlement Amid Broader Fraud Crackdown

Kazakhstan has initiated 14 investigations into the embezzlement of OSMS funds, according to the Agency for Financial Monitoring. The agency also reported uncovering risks of inefficient subsidy use in livestock and grant misappropriation. These developments come as the government intensifies its crackdown on financial fraud.

Financial Monitoring Report

The Agency for Financial Monitoring reported to President Kassym-Jomart Tokayev that 14 pre-trial investigations have been launched into the embezzlement of OSMS funds. Additionally, 21 criminal cases are being investigated for the misappropriation of 5.3 billion tenge in construction projects. The agency also identified risks of inefficient use of 30 billion tenge in livestock subsidies and over 10 billion tenge in research grants, according to Kazakhstanskaya Pravda.

Fraud and Money Laundering Crackdown

The agency has dismantled 17 financial pyramids and exposed a group conducting mass phishing SMS campaigns. Over 3,700 fraudulent websites and 22 group chats with more than 25,000 participants have been shut down. In efforts against money laundering, 68,000 drop cards were blocked, and three shadow cryptocurrency exchanges were closed, Vlast.kz reported.
